Talking points: Atlético roll over Las Palmas in LALIGA
Photo by Angel Martinez/Getty Images
A big win before travelling to Milan. Atlético Madrid secured a thumping 5-0 win over Las Palmas on Saturday as they looked ahead to a tricky Champions League tie against Internazionale on Tuesday night.
The win came from a pair of braces from a makeshift front two of Marcos Llorente and Ángel Correa, with the Argentine setting up the Spaniard for one of his goals and Llorente allowing Correa to take a penalty to open his account for the day later on. Substitute Memphis Depay later came on to complete the set and make it five goals for the home team, scoring for fun against a Las Palmas team who had only conceded 20 goals in 24 games before this encounter.
Here are four of the key talking points from the game. 1. Should either of the front two be regular starters"
One of the surprises for this game was who lined up in attack, with Diego Simeone clearly determined to rotate and rest Antoine Griezmann and Memphis Depay with Álvaro Morata already ruled out through injury and racing back to be fit. He went with Ángel Correa and, alongside him, Marcos Llorente.
It worked a treat, with their energy and pressing unsettling the Las Palmas defence, who were forced into errors and mistakes and opened up and provided space for Atleti to attack. It was a completely different look to the Atleti offense that visited the Canary Islands earlier in the season and the opposition were not prepared.
